The RuneScape Wiki Events Team is a small group of users who create regular events for the RuneScape Wiki community. All events are aimed at everyone who wants to come - you do not need to be an editor, have an account or be part of the clan chat to come to events.

The friends chat used for events organised by the Events Team will usually be one of the friends chats of the Events Team members - check each individual event page for full details.

FAQ

What are the rules of attending an event?

All rules should be common sense:

  • All Rules of RuneScape, and wiki rules apply.
  • Being rude or disruptive may result in removal from the event. This includes rudeness towards others in the area who are not part of the event. (Not being a part of the friends chat may mean you are not considered part of the event.) Should an event be crashed, the Events Team will organise a world hop.
  • Backseat moderating is not appreciated. Please let the Events Team or other moderators in the friends chat (i.e. ranked users) deal with any rule breaking. Let them know if you believe someone is breaking the rules, but do not take it into your own hands.
  • Understand the event. Every boss or minigame done by the Events Team has some strategy to follow. Never having the done the boss or minigame is fine; however it is expected that you read the strategy that is laid out on the event's page. A list of all written ET guides can be found here.
  • Most importantly, have fun! Events are put on for the community to have a good time together, be it working with each other in a boss event or working against each other in a competitive event.

How are members of the Events Team chosen?

New members will be chosen when the team requires new members (a member leaving, workload getting high, etc). Interested users may nominate themselves at the RfET page. To pass, the user must attain consensus from the community that he or she is will be a qualified member of the Events Team. Furthermore, due to the nature of the team, the current/remaining members of the team hold veto power over any member chosen by the community.
